Signed-off-by: Song Liu --- fs/namei.c | 52 +++++++++++++++++++++++++++++++++++++++++++ include/linux/namei.h | 2 ++ 2 files changed, 54 insertions(+) diff --git a/fs/namei.c b/fs/namei.c index 4bb889fc980b..7d5bf2bb604f 100644 --- a/fs/namei.c +++ b/fs/namei.c @@ -1424,6 +1424,58 @@ static bool choose_mountpoint(struct mount *m, const struct path *root, return found; } +/** + * path_walk_parent - Walk to the parent of path + * @path: input and output path. + * @root: root of the path walk, do not go beyond this root. If @root is + * zero'ed, walk all the way to real root. + * + * Given a path, find the parent path. Replace @path with the parent path. + * If we were already at the real root or a disconnected root, @path is + * not changed. + * + * The logic of path_walk_parent() is similar to follow_dotdot(), except + * that path_walk_parent() will continue walking for !path_connected case. + * This effectively means we are walking from disconnectedbind mount to the + * original mount point.
